Goat (2026)

Goat (2026) is an upcoming animated sports comedy directed by Tyree Dillihay (with Adam Rosette as co-director) and produced by Stephen Curry, Michelle Raimo Kouyate, Erick Peyton, Adam Rosenberg, and Rodney Rothman under Sony Pictures Animation.

The film follows Will Harris (voiced by Caleb McLaughlin), a determined little goat who dreams of making it in the high-intensity, full-contact sport of roarball against much larger and tougher competitors. Despite skepticism from his new teammates, Will sets out to prove that even the smallest players can make a big impact on the game. Along the way he crosses paths with stars like Jett Fillmore (Gabrielle Union), Lenny Williamson (Stephen Curry), and others who populate this all-animal world. With themes of perseverance, teamwork, and self-belief, Goat blends humour and heart in a family-friendly underdog story.

Goat (2026) is inspired by a book. It was inspired by the book Funky Dunks by Chris Tougas, although it is an original animated film with its own story adapted for the screen

The film is scheduled for theatrical release on 26 March 2026 in Australia.

Review

GOAT is a lively animated sports comedy set in a world where anthropomorphic animals compete in a fast-paced game called roarball, a basketball-style sport played at the professional level.

The story follows small but determined goat Will Harris (voiced by Caleb McLaughlin), who unexpectedly earns a spot on the struggling Vineland Thorns team despite being surrounded by much larger and stronger players. As the smallest athlete on the court, Will has to prove he belongs while winning over teammates who initially doubt him.

Produced by NBA star Stephen Curry, the film leans into a classic underdog story about believing in yourself and showing that “smalls can ball.” With energetic roarball matches, colourful animation, and plenty of humour from its animal characters, it’s especially fun for basketball fans and Curry supporters.

Ultimately, the cute, smart and funny cast of animated animals makes GOAT a charming family movie that’s likely to delight younger viewers. My son absolutely love it! 😊
